/*
 * Maximum age, in seconds, of a password reset link under the
 * revamped Holloway flow. Shortened from 24h after the Bramleigh
 * audit flagged long-lived tokens. Do not raise without sign-off
 * from the identity team. Validated against the build noted below.
 */

pipeline stamp: htk4_ae36

### Runbook — Spoolbird print queue stuck

If tickets come in saying print jobs from the Harlowe office are sitting in "pending" forever, odds are the Spoolbird worker lost its lease on the queue and is quietly sulking. First, restart the worker pod — that fixes it nine times out of ten. If jobs still don't move, check that the retry backoff and lease timeout haven't been fiddled with, since those are the usual suspects after a hotfix. The values the service should be running with are listed below.

service settings:
druael:
  log_level: error
  metrics_host: metrics.druael.tolvaqlabs.internal
  pool_size: 16

RUNBOOK — Greywater intake, Dunmere Reservoir

Samples arrive daily 09:30 via Calder Courier in chilled cases. Receiving site: log case temperature on arrival; reject anything above 6°C. Transfer bottles to Fridge B within ten minutes. Sign the chain-of-custody sheet in full. No partial acceptance — whole case or refusal. Courier hand-over proceeds per the instruction below.

courier memo of yawep-yafog: the pramir ulaix courier leaves the ulavan aldix frair zorok oliiel joreth rusdor fenvan ledger at gate 1305 under passcode 514738